Must-Try Hashbrowns and Sides With Prices

affordable customizable hashbrowns

If you’re craving a savory complement to your meal, Waffle House’s hashbrowns and sides are a must-try. You’ll find several hashbrowns varieties to customize your plate exactly how you like. Whether you want them “scattered” (spread on the grill), “smothered” with onions, “covered” with melted cheese, or “chunked” with ham, you’re in for a flavorful experience.

Prices for these hashbrowns varieties start around $3.50, making them an affordable way to boost your meal.

Alongside hashbrowns, Waffle House offers a variety of side dish options to round out your order. You can enjoy classic breakfast staples like bacon and sausage, or opt for eggs cooked your way.

Sides such as grits, toast, or biscuits are also available, typically priced between $1.50 and $3. These options let you create a satisfying and well-balanced meal without breaking the bank.

How Waffle House Prices Vary by Location

How much you pay at Waffle House can depend on where you order. The restaurant uses regional pricing to adjust menu costs based on local factors like rent, labor, and ingredient availability.

This location impact means prices can vary noticeably from one city or state to another. For example, you might find a breakfast combo costs a bit more in urban areas compared to smaller towns.

When you visit different Waffle House locations, keep in mind that these price changes reflect local economic conditions rather than inconsistency or hidden fees. Understanding this regional pricing approach helps you set realistic expectations before you go.

If you’re budgeting for a meal, checking the menu prices online for your specific location is a smart move. That way, you’ll know exactly what to expect, no surprises at the register.

Does Waffle House Offer Gluten-Free Menu Options?

Waffle House doesn’t have a dedicated gluten-free menu, but you can find some gluten-free options if you’re careful. If you have dietary restrictions, you’ll want to avoid items with bread, waffles, or batter.

Eggs, hashbrowns, and some sides can be safe choices, but cross-contamination is possible. It’s best to talk to your server about gluten-free options and how they handle your dietary needs before ordering.

Are There Any Vegan Dishes Available at Waffle House?

You won’t find many dedicated vegan breakfast options at Waffle House, but you can create some plant-based options by customizing your order. Try their hashbrowns cooked without butter or cheese, and ask for grilled veggies if available.

Avoid eggs, cheese, and meat to keep it vegan. While the menu isn’t focused on plant-based dishes, you can still piece together a simple vegan breakfast with a little creativity.
